Abstract

Tourism is a worldwide phenomenon since humans have always been nomads as a result of evolution. The purpose of the paper is to investigate the many socioeconomic aspects of foreign visitors. Visitors commonly come to India because it has a diverse population with a lengthy history. People from other nations visit India for a variety of purposes, including business, healthcare, tourism, and other travel. The paper also examines the fundamental components of visitor perceptions according to categories like age, sex, marital status, income levels, and so forth. In order to provide a clearer image of tourism from the viewpoint of foreign visitors and to learn what they think about the nation and its people, the data collected are combined, analysed, and evaluated.
